Sejong Prize Rules and Information
submission deadline June 30, 2012
Eligibility
- Open to all composers regardless of age or nationality.
- First place winners of the previous competitions are not eligible.
Piece Requirements
- Pieces should be written as duo or trio for piano, violin, and/or cello.
- Playing time must be less than 12 minutes.
- Judges are looking for originality, basic skills (i.e. technique), and Korean themes and expressions.
- The piece must contain elements of traditional Korean melodies. Contestants must use one of the traditional Korean melodies posted on our website. Transcriptions and recordings of the melodies performed by Korean instruments can be found on our list of traditional Korean music.
- Please keep in mind that we are looking for pieces that can strongly convey Korean themes.
Submission Guidelines
- The application should include a short paragraph (up to 500 words) that explains how the Korean theme was expressed in the entry.
- Entry and application form must be sent as email attachments to sejong@sejongculturalsociety.org. The subject of the email should be "Sejong Prize". Entries and applications must be sent together or they will not be accepted.
- Entries must be submitted in a PDF (.pdf) or Finale (.mus) format. Printed scores will not be accepted.
- The entrant's name and contact details must not appear on any page of the score. However, file names should include the contestant's name (e.g. JohnSmith.mus)
Prizes
- Winner $1,500; Honorable Mention (2-3) $200
- Winning entries will be performed and recorded by the Lincoln Trio.
- Any of the winning entries may be subject to the following:
- Publication of music score
- Performance of selected work broadcast over Korean television or radio stations
- Winners will be announced in the Korea Times of Chicago and on our website.
